But my ULTIMATE toys are my bridges. I have 3, a WWII pontoon treadway, a ponton treadway and a WWII Bailey. They are about 1:10 scale. They are models that the military used to train combat engineers with when they couldn't get the real bridges or the weather was too inclimate. As the military has totally migrated to the MGB (Medium Girder Bridge), they threw out their old models and I've been scooping them up on ebay! Check 'em out...... www.photos.yahoo.com/ender098

Yeah, those junk stores have given me tons of unique tools. I have chairs from a $1 barbie (or Little bratz) knock-off set, they were pink, but nothing a $.97 can of gray primer couldn't fix!

I got a knock off set of joe like figures, they were trash, but the set had like 6 knock off Torpedo V1 spearguns! I outfitted all my seals with backup weapons. Keep on the lookout, and remember if the color is off...spraypaint it! LOL!
